豌豆Ai站群搜索引擎系统 V.25.10.25 网址:www.wd.chat

🗣 Wd提问: 给云服务器安装mysql

🤖 Ai回答:
以下是给云服务器安装MySQL的详细步骤,适用于主流Linux发行版(如Ubuntu、CentOS):

1、更新系统
bash
Ubuntu/Debian
sudo apt update && sudo apt upgrade -y

CentOS/RHEL
sudo yum update -y

2、安装MySQL
Ubuntu/Debian
bash
sudo apt install mysql-server -y

CentOS/RHEL
bash
sudo yum install mysql-server -y

3、启动并设置开机自启
bash
sudo systemctl start mysql
sudo systemctl enable mysql

4、运行安全配置向导
bash
sudo mysql_secure_installation

按提示完成以下操作:
设置root密码(需记录)
移除匿名用户(Y)
禁止root远程登录(Y)
删除测试数据库(Y)
重新加载权限表(Y)

5、验证安装
bash
sudo systemctl status mysql

若显示`active (running)`则表示成功。

6、创建新用户和数据库(可选)
bash
sudo mysql -u root -p

输入密码后执行:
sql
CREATE DATABASE mydb;
CREATE USER 'newuser'@'localhost' IDENTIFIED BY 'password';
GRANT ALL PRIVILEGES ON mydb.* TO 'newuser'@'localhost';
FLUSH PRIVILEGES;
EXIT;

7、配置远程访问(可选)
编辑MySQL配置文件:
bash
sudo nano /etc/mysql/mysql.conf.d/mysqld.cnf

找到`bind-address`,改为`0.0.0.0`允许所有IP连接(生产环境建议指定IP)。

重启服务:
bash
sudo systemctl restart mysql

8、开放防火墙端口
bash
Ubuntu/Debian
sudo ufw allow 3306/tcp

CentOS/RHEL
sudo firewall-cmd permanent add-port=3306/tcp
sudo firewall-cmd reload

9、基础优化(可选)
编辑配置文件:
bash
sudo nano /etc/mysql/my.cnf

添加或修改:
ini
[mysqld]
character-set-server=utf8mb4
collation-server=utf8mb4_unicode_ci
max_connections = 200
innodb_buffer_pool_size = 2G 根据内存调整

重启服务生效:
bash
sudo systemctl restart mysql

常见问题
忘记密码?
bash
sudo mysqld_safe skip-grant-tables &
mysql -u root

执行:
sql
ALTER USER 'root'@'localhost' IDENTIFIED BY 'new_password';
FLUSH PRIVILEGES;


连接超时?
检查防火墙规则或VPC安全组是否开放3306端口。

通过以上步骤,您已完成MySQL的基本安装与配置。建议进一步学习备份策略(如`mysqldump`)和性能调优。

Ai作答

📣 商家广告


高防vps

广告招商

广告招商

月饼

公司域名


0

IP地址: 251.254.7.39

搜索次数: 14

提问时间: 2025-12-05 03:00:31

🛒 域名购买

❓️ 热门提问

🌐 域名评估

最新挖掘

🖌 热门作画

🤝 关于我们

🗨 加入群聊

🔗 友情链接

🧰 站长工具
📢

温馨提示

本站所有 问答 均由Ai自动分析整理,内容仅供参考,若有误差请用“联系”里面信息通知我们人工修改或删除。

👉

技术支持

本站由 🟢 豌豆Ai 提供技术支持,使用的最新版: 豌豆Ai站群搜索引擎系统 V.25.10.25 搭建本站。

上一篇 94995 94996 94997 下一篇